When it came to Claire, though, the reporters couldn’t help but pry a little deeper.

“Claire, you even competed in the Math Olympiad during your senior year. How did you manage your time so well?”

“Frankly,” Claire replied, “I didn’t manage it that well at all. I just powered through on sheer will.”

The reporter raised an eyebrow. “What kind of willpower is that?”

“Uh… I guess I just wanted to do my part for the national team?” Claire blurted, not even sure herself—she’d made it up on the spot, never expecting the reporter to run with it.

“It sounds like Claire is a real patriot,” the reporter declared, quick to seize the angle.

“So you chose to take the college entrance exam—was it to prove something to yourself?”

“No, not really. I just wanted to switch majors. I didn’t want to study math,” Claire answered, completely candid.

The reporter stared into Claire’s wide, honest eyes, almost dazzled by her sincerity.

How do you even explain this?

It was almost unbelievable—she just didn’t like math! She turned down an automatic admission offer because she wanted to major in something else, and casually aced the toughest exam in the country on her own just to do it.

The reporter remembered her own struggles with those exams—she’d barely survived.

Was this what it was like to live in the world of the truly gifted? Choosing whatever field you wanted, breezing through with effortless confidence?

“Do you have any advice you’d like to share with the students coming up after you?”

Claire smiled. “If studying doesn’t kill you, then study like your life depends on it. The results will speak for themselves. Good luck!”

The reporter let out a nervous chuckle. “Claire really does get straight to the point.”
